Rudjek/The Heron
Rudjek (c. 81 BCE – 48 BCE), also known as The Heron, was the nomarch of Saqqara Nome and a member of the Order of the Ancients during the reign of Pharaoh Ptolemy XIII.
In his quest to access the Isu vault in Siwa, Rudjek became one of the five in the Order directly responsible for the death of Khemu, son of the Medjay Bayek, in 49 BCE.
